What companies run services between Waterloo (Merseyside), England and London, England?
Avanti West Coast operates a train from Liverpool Lime Street to London Euston hourly. Tickets cost £65–120 and the journey takes 2h 20m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Liverpool, Liverpool One to London Victoria 5 times a day. Tickets cost £20–35 and the journey takes 5h 50m.
